"Sickness" is defined in Ballentine's Law Dictionary as "the condition of being sick. A condition interfering with one's usual. activities. Any affection of the body which deprives it temporarily of the.power to fulfill its usual functions. A diseased condition which has advanced far enough to incapacitate." And "sickness" is defined in Black's Law Dictionary as "disease; malady; any morbid condition of the body (including insanity) which for the time being hinders or prevents the organs from normally disch~arging their several functions. Any affection of the body which deprives it temporarily of the power to fulfill its usual functions."
